Output 51ea03eee70d046a4795af2690f49005eb5103a36e689a785b59fbda0cd95a5e:3

value
143817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7495e60fe60c183ede2dfb7dccd16d70ba7d5ba OP_EQUAL
address
3NmwubouptL9Q7DCi3JUUZp4ZkVKqutto6
transaction
51ea03eee70d046a4795af2690f49005eb5103a36e689a785b59fbda0cd95a5e
confirmations
200299
spent
true